About Carroll County, Maryland
Carroll County in Maryland has a median household income of $111,672 and median home value of $390,200. With an estimated payback period of 2 years, solar is a strong investment for homeowners in this area.
These estimates use county-level medians and national averages for solar irradiance. Your actual ROI depends on roof orientation, shading, local utility rates, and available state/local incentives beyond the federal 30% ITC.
